Product Description

Applying a comprehensive theory of character to the Gospel of John, Cornelis Bennema provides a fresh analysis of both the characters and their responses to Jesus. While the majority of scholars view most Johannine characters as "flat," Bennema demonstrates that many are complex, developing, and "round." John's broad array of characters and their responses to Jesus correspond to people and their choices in real life in any culture and time. This book highlights how John's Gospel seeks to challenge its readers, past and present, about where they stand in relation to Jesus.

Author Bio

Cornelis Bennema is senior lecturer in New Testament at the Wales Evangelical School of Theology ,UK, and Extraordinary Associate Professor, Unit for Reformed Theology and the Development of the South African Society, Faculty of Theology, North-West University, South Africa. He is the author of The Power of Saving Wisdom,An Investigation of Spirit and Wisdom in Relation to the Soteriology of the Fourth Gospel (2002),A Theory of Character in New Testament Narrative (2014),Encountering Jesus: Character Studies in the Gospel of John,second edition (2014), and co-editor of The Spirit and Christ in the New Testament and Christian Theology (2012).
